|
|
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
таблица с id, text и пр. нужно очистить текст от всех символов и пробелов, кроме букв. пока рабочий, но крайне нудный и требующий подстановки для каждого символа, вариант: Код: sql 1. как можно объединить запрос, чтобы скопом убрать .,:; !? и т.д.?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 18.05.2014, 20:40:45 |
|
||
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
sunshi, в мускуле регулярки только для поиска, для замены нет. Сделайте на php к примеру.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2014, 09:33:33 |
|
||
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
sunshiтаблица с id, text и пр. нужно очистить текст от всех символов и пробелов, кроме букв. пока рабочий, но крайне нудный и требующий подстановки для каждого символа, вариант: Код: sql 1. как можно объединить запрос, чтобы скопом убрать .,:; !? и т.д.?легко и непринужденно Код: sql 1. 2. 3. 4. 5. 6. 7. 8.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2014, 09:46:39 |
|
||
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
как вариант, Код: sql 1. 2. 3. 4.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2014, 09:50:36 |
|
||
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
При большом или неопределенном количестве мусорных символов, наверное, уже выгоднее свою функцию написать, чтобы за один проход по строке работать. За образец можно взять оракловую функцию TRANSLATE().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 19.05.2014, 10:08:48 |
|
||
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
при добавлении в таблицу текст обрабатывается на php, вопрос касался именно уже имеющихся данных таблицы... последний вариант - похоже то, что нужно. сп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.05.2014, 02:42:17 |
|
||
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
sunshiпри добавлении в таблицу текст обрабатывается на php, вопрос касался именно уже имеющихся данных таблицы... последний вариант - похоже то, что нужно. спасибо. последний вариант не слишком читаем, по-моему. Первый однако в этом плане намного лучше :-)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.05.2014, 08:48:08 |
|
||
|
Можно ли очистить текст?
|
|||
|---|---|---|---|
|
#18+
мне совершенно не хватает знаний, поэтому я никак не могу решить как лучше и правильно сделать, постоянно пробую варианты - сейчас, при очистке в запросе, одной строкой удобнее... вот кстати, может быть подскажете как лучше реализовать при следующих условиях: очистка текста нужна для последующего поиска дублей, использоваться будет относительно редко: в большей степени при администрировании данных (здесь не важна скорость - в разумных пределах) + при добавлении текста через форму сайта (скорость в приоритете). стоит ли делать дополнительную таблицу с полем для хранения очищенного текста и впоследствии искать дубли по нему или оставить одно поле "текст" и на лету очищать и сравнивать? при условии, что сервер не очень хочется нагружать...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.05.2014, 17:58:29 |
|
||
|
|

start [/forum/topic.php?fid=47&msg=38644638&tid=1834795]: |
0ms |
get settings: |
8ms |
get forum list: |
12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
78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
33ms |
get tp. blocked users: |
1ms |
| others: | 227ms |
| total: | 375ms |

| 0 / 0 |
